What Is Acne Scar Treatment?
Acne scar treatment encompasses a range of medical procedures aimed at reducing or removing the visibility of scars left behind by acne. In Korea, treatment plans are highly personalized and often combine technologies to rebuild collagen, smooth irregularities, and refine skin texture. Protocols can include resurfacing lasers, RF microneedling, subcision, targeted chemical methods like TCA CROSS, biologic skin boosters (e.g., Rejuran Healer skin), and supportive facials such as aqua peel to optimize the canvas before/after procedures.

Types of Acne Scar Treatment
There are various types of acne scar treatments available, each with its own specific benefits and suitable use cases:
1. Laser Therapy
Laser therapy targets the scarred area with focused light, either removing the outer layer of skin (ablative lasers) or stimulating collagen production underneath the skin (non-ablative lasers). Korea commonly combines fractional COâ‚‚/Er:YAG with picosecond lasers for textural remodeling and pigment blending.
Pros:
-
Effective for various scar types (boxcar, rolling; selective protocols for icepick with TCA CROSS)
-
Stimulates collagen production and improves skin texture
Cons:
-
Can be expensive and requires multiple sessions
-
Temporary redness/irritation; PIH risk if aftercare/sun care lapses
2. Chemical Peels
Chemical peels involve applying a chemical solution to the skin, causing it to exfoliate and peel off. Beyond standard AHA/BHA peels, Korean clinics may perform focal TCA CROSS for icepick scars and use aqua peel devices to deep-clean and hydrate as pre- or post-care.
Pros:
-
Helpful for superficial scars and dyschromia
-
Scalable from mild aqua peel maintenance to deeper TCA options
Cons:
-
Temporary redness and peeling
-
Hyperpigmentation risk without strict UV protection
3. Microneedling
Microneedling uses t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in, promoting the body’s natural healing process and collagen production. RF-assisted microneedling adds heat to improve tightening and scar remodeling. It’s often paired with biologics such as PRP, exosomes, or Rejuran Healer skin boosters to enhance repair.
Pros:
-
Minimally invasive with broad skin-type compatibility
-
Synergizes with PRP/exosomes/Rejuran Healer skin for texture gains
Cons:
-
Multiple sessions needed
-
Temporary swelling/redness; strict hygiene required
4. Dermal Fillers
Dermal fillers (commonly hyaluronic acid) are injected to lift depressed scars and can be combined with subcision for rolling scars. In Korea, careful micro-droplet placement reduces shadowing that makes scars appear deeper.
Pros:
-
Immediate improvement in contour
-
Minimally invasive with adjustable outcomes
Cons:
-
Temporary results; touch-ups needed
-
Rare risks include vascular occlusion; must be performed by experts
5. Subcision
Subcision involves inserting a needle below the scar to break up fibrous bands tethering the skin. It is frequently paired with fillers, RF microneedling, or Rejuran Healer skin to prevent re-tethering and stimulate remodeling.
Pros:
-
Highly effective for rolling scars
-
Long-lasting structural improvement
Cons:
-
Bruising and swelling possible
-
Often done in a series for optimal outcomes
6. Excision and Punch Techniques
For deeper, more severe acne scars, surgical methods like excision or punch techniques can be used to physically remove the scar tissue, followed by resurfacing for blend.
Pros:
-
Targeted solution for refractory scars (e.g., icepick, deep boxcar)
-
Permanent removal of the worst lesions
Cons:
-
Invasive and requires downtime
-
Post-surgical care needed to minimize new marks

Acne Scar Treatment in Korea

When it comes to acne scar treatment, South Korea has emerged as a global hub, attracting numerous international patients looking for advanced, combination-based solutions. Clinics emphasize protocols that sequence decongestion (e.g., aqua peel) → collagen induction (RF microneedling/lasers) → biologic boosters (PRP, exosomes, Rejuran Healer skin) to steadily restore skin texture.
Initial Consultation
Your visit begins with a high-resolution skin analysis (texture depth maps, pigment/erythema imaging) and a scar-type charting (icepick, boxcar, rolling). Plans also screen for ongoing acne; in beard or jawline breakouts, adjunct laser hair removal may be recommended to reduce ingrown hairs and folliculitis that can aggravate scarring. Pre-care typically includes SPF optimization and, if needed, gentle aqua peel to clear pores.
Treatment Options
Korean dermatology clinics offer a wide range of advanced acne scar treatments. Depending on scar type and downtime tolerance, your dermatologist may recommend one or more of the following:
- Laser Treatments: Fractional COâ‚‚/Er:YAG for resurfacing; picosecond lasers for pigment and micro-texturing; cautious parameters for darker skin to limit PIH.
- Microneedling/RF Microneedling: Mechanical + thermal collagen induction; often combined with PRP/exosomes/Rejuran Healer skin for enhanced remodeling.
- Chemical Methods: Focal TCA CROSS for icepick scars; broader peels for tone/texture; aqua peel for maintenance and pre-laser prep.
- Subcision + Fillers: Releases tethers, then lifts the plane to reduce shadowing; staged across sessions.
- Biologic/Regenerative Adjuncts: PRP and exosome serums; Rejuran Healer skin boosters (polynucleotides) to support matrix repair.
- Targeted Surgery: Punch excision/grafting for deep, narrow scars followed by blending laser.
Note: Body contouring options like fat dissolving injection (a fat dissolving approach under the chin) are not scar treatments but are sometimes requested alongside facial procedures in Korea for profile refinement. They do not treat scars directly but can improve overall facial contours.
Advanced Technology
Clinics emphasize calibrated energy delivery (stacking passes, spacing sessions 4–8 weeks) and cooling/insulation technologies to reduce downtime. Emerging regenerative care may reference stem cell–derived exosomes (topical or micro-channeled) as an adjunct to support recovery; these are used as cosmetic adjuvants rather than standalone cures.
Aftercare and Follow-Up
Post-procedure care focuses on barrier repair (ceramides, panthenol), sun avoidance (SPF 50+), and pigment control if needed. Gentle cleansing, temporary activity limits, and scheduled aqua peel maintenance can keep pores clear while your collagen remodels. For those with beard-area irritation, spacing laser hair removal sessions around resurfacing helps avoid overlap irritation.

Alternatives to Acne Scar Treatment
Acne scars can be resistant, and not everyone is ready for procedural care. Consider these evidence-based alternatives or complements:
Chemical Peels
Chemical peels (superficial to medium) can gradually blend tone and soften minor texture. As a low-downtime complement, aqua peel supports decongestion and hydration between stronger sessions, helping maintain smoother skin texture.
Laser Treatment
If you’re not ready for ablative resurfacing, non-ablative lasers and picosecond devices can incrementally improve texture and pigment with less downtime. Remember: procedures like laser hair removal are not scar treatments but can reduce folliculitis-related breakouts that worsen scarring along the jawline/neck.
Microneedling
Microneedling—with or without RF—offers steady remodeling over multiple visits. Pairing with PRP/exosomes or Rejuran Healer skin can enhance glow and elasticity. These combinations are popular in Korea for scar care and overall texture refinement.
